Biography
Prashant Mali, PhD, is a Professor in the Shu Chien-Gene Lay Department of Bioengineering at the University of California San Diego. His research spans the exciting fields of synthetic biology and regenerative medicine. Dr. Malis lab is at the forefront of developing toolsets for systematic genome interpretation and gene therapy applications, focusing on genome and transcriptome engineering. Dr. Mali has been instrumental in pioneering CRISPRs and ADARs as powerful tools for DNA and RNA editing, significantly impacting basic biology and human therapeutics. He holds degrees in Electrical Engineering from the Indian Institute of Technology Bombay and a doctorate in Biomedical Engineering from Johns Hopkins University. He has been named a Highly Cited Researcher by Clarivate and was elected to the American Institute for Medical and Biological Engineering in 2022 and the National Academy of Inventors in 2023.
